New nucleoside building blocks for the synthesis of functional DNA are presented. A porphyrin-bis nucleoside dU-porphyrin-dU was synthesised from a di-acetylene-substituted porphyrin using Sonogashira coupling with 5-iodo deoxy uridine. The same strategy was used to obtain a new terpy-functionalised nucleoside dU(terpy). This building block can be metallated with ruthenium(II) either to make a mono-nucleoside ruthenium complex (dU(terpy)) Ru-II(terpy), or to connect two building blocks to create a bis-nucleoside (dU(terpy))(2)Ru-II. The terpy nucleoside building block dU(terpy) was incorporated into short strands of DNA to give TXT, TXXT and TXXXT as sequences (X = dU(terpy)). The functionalised DNA has the potential to create supramolecular assemblies through metal complexation.
